In Christian iconography, stained glass is a story frozen in light, intended to edify the faithful. The one at Hellfest , installed in the festival chapel in Clisson, diverts this ancestral format to infuse it with a devotion of another order: that of metal .
The musician depicted here, adorned with Jack Daniel's and a sacred guitar , evokes Lemmy Kilmister , the legendary figure of Motörhead, often venerated as a pagan saint by fans.
This hybridization of religious art and rock culture is not insignificant. It is part of a very real tradition of “Sacred Rock” : in Europe, several churches have been converted into concert halls, and in Japan, some Buddhist temples organize rituals with metal music to reach younger generations.
Hellfest, by dedicating a space to this stained glass window, questions our need for rituals , collective transcendence , and tutelary figures in a secularized society.
